1981
 
Narrative history in HistoryWorld      
Muslim terrorists assassinate Anwar el-Sadat, in response to his peace agreement with Israel        
1982
 
    
Sun Myung Moon, founder of the Unification Church (or 'Moonies'), is convicted in the USA of tax fraud and imprisoned       
1982
 
   
Christian militiamen massacre Palestinian refugees in the Sabra and Chatila camps in Lebanon      
1982
 
   
Hezbollah emerges in Lebanon as an Iranian-sponsored resistance movement against the Israeli occupation of the southern part of the country      
1983
 
   
Government imposition of Islamic law (sharia) triggers renewed civil war in Sudan between the Muslim north and Christian south      
1984
 
     
Sikh rebels, demanding an independent Punjab, seize the Golden Temple in Amritsar        
1986
 
   
Desmond Tutu is the first black African to be archbishop of Cape Town      
1987
 
   
An Intifada begins against Israeli occupation of Palestinian land      
1987
 
   
Hamas (acronym in Arabic for 'Movement for Islamic Resistance') is founded in the occupied territories to lead armed resistance against Israel      
1988
 
     
Ayatollah Khomeini declares a fatwa against Salman Rushdie for his Satanic Verses
